It should be noted that the rainy season from the end of May to August will often interrupt the Sichuan-Tibet line due to landslides or mudslides, and rain will also make unpaved roads in northern Tibet more muddy and increase the risk of traffic jams. 165438+ Every year1from the end of October to March and April of the following year, the highways in Ali and Naqu areas are often closed due to the weather, and snow and dark ice are prone to appear in the high-altitude Yakou section. It is recommended not to drive into Tibet in winter. If you want to drive by car, you can rent a car or charter a car in a bigger city.
